Transaction 73d598b0594a84108d1355db91aed6d65a9a527260fb6b51d866ff80cb2ed7fc
1 Input
1 Output
-
73d598b0594a84108d1355db91aed6d65a9a527260fb6b51d866ff80cb2ed7fc:0
- value
- 189811648
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 af3045d76d8bf3c9e582c2926bf9de110e938be6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GyK5dDykkye8HkvxF1us9Ro5T45AtVZWW